The successful candidate will perform as Principal Systems Engineer – Design Assurance within Disneyland Resort’s Global Engineering and Technology (GE&T) division. This person will be responsible for providing oversight and guidance to the engineering teams, including leadership, which includes approximately 150 total team members. The Design Assurance charter is to ensure that the safety of Guests and Cast is the number one focus of our engineering work by overseeing and driving a culture of technical excellence and global consistency. These objectives are accomplished by providing training, mentorship, supporting project reviews, fostering the development and integration of engineering standards and rigor, as well as supporting and applying best practices. While direct administrative responsibilities are limited, effective collaboration with the engineering leadership team and global Design Assurance remains critical for achieving both technical excellence and favorable business outcomes.
The Principal Systems Engineer – Design Assurance role is a Full-Time in-person role based in Anaheim, CA, reporting to the Director of Global Engineering & Technology at the Disneyland Resort.

Required Qualifications & Skills
This is what you will need to be successful in the role:
Minimum of 15+ years of experience in technical roles focused on the design, troubleshooting, and maintenance of complex, safety related mechanical systems.
Extensive experience in Themed Entertainment, specifically in the design and sustainment of Ride Systems.
Advanced engineering knowledge (e.g. statics, dynamics, kinematics, stress/strain/fatigue).
Advanced engineering expertise (e.g., machine design, weldments, power train, materials).
Proficiency with engineering tools (e.g., Solid Modeling, FEA, Engineering calculation software, Engineering programming and modeling software - e.g. MatLab).
Comprehensive knowledge of themed entertainment standards (e.g. ASTM F24, Cal OSHA 6.2…) and their effective application.
Comprehensive knowledge of industrial standards (e.g. ASME, SAE-AMS, AWS, ANSI…).
Strong written and verbal communication skills.
Skilled at identifying priority system-level risks and resolving team technical conflicts.
Ability to read and understand integrated drawing packages including detailed and tolerance part through assembly drawings, system level documents including theory of operations, maintenance and installation manuals.

About Disneyland Resort:
When Walt Disney opened Disneyland on July 17, 1955, he said he hoped it would be “a source of joy and inspiration to all the world.” Since then, the Disneyland Resort has welcomed more than 800 million guests, expanding to become an approximately 500- acre, multifaceted, world-class family resort destination, complete with two renowned Disney theme parks, three hotels and the exciting shopping, dining and entertainment area known as Downtown Disney District. Through a combination of creativity, technology and innovation, the resort brings storytelling to new heights, and Disneyland Resort cast members play an integral part in bringing that Disney magic to life for thousands of guests every day.
